federer’s‍ Legacy Honored

Roger Federer, the Swiss tennis icon, ​will be inducted ‌into ⁣the ⁣International ⁢Tennis Hall of Fame ‌in August 2024. The announcement,​ made on November ‌25, 2023, recognizes Federer’s extraordinary career and contributions to the sport. ⁣He joins​ a prestigious group of tennis legends ‍already enshrined in the Hall‌ of Fame, including fellow⁣ British greats Fred‍ Perry⁣ and Virginia ​Wade.

Federer ​expressed his gratitude, stating, “I’ve ​always⁢ valued the history ⁤of tennis and the⁣ example ⁤set by those who came⁢ before me.” He added, “To be recognised in this way by the sport and ‍by my peers is deeply humbling. I look‌ forward to visiting ⁤Newport next August ⁣to celebrate this special‍ moment with​ the tennis community.”

A career Defined by Excellence

Federer’s⁢ impact on tennis is⁣ undeniable. He secured 20 ⁣Grand Slam ⁢singles titles, a record he held for several years, including a remarkable eight Wimbledon championships – the most of any male player. Wimbledon official records confirm his⁢ dominance at the All England Club.

Beyond ‌Grand Slams, ⁢Federer ‌demonstrated consistent excellence, holding the‌ world No. ‌1 ranking for ⁢a total⁤ of 310 weeks, including a record-breaking ⁢237 consecutive weeks, according to the official ATP Tour announcement.‌ This sustained period at ⁣the top underscores his longevity and unwavering‍ performance.

Statistic Value
Grand Slam Singles Titles 20
Wimbledon Titles 8
Total‌ Weeks‍ at No. 1 310
Consecutive Weeks at ‍No. 1 237

Carillo Also Honored

Alongside Federer, broadcaster and journalist Mary Carillo will be inducted in the ‌Contributor Category. ‍Carillo has ⁤been a prominent voice in tennis‌ broadcasting⁢ for decades,known for ​her insightful commentary and⁣ engaging personality. Her‍ contributions to the sport ‍extend ‌beyond the court, enriching the viewing experience for fans worldwide.
